Bathtub faucet rep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ues with the fixtures that supply water to a bathtub. This includes addressing leaks, drips, or irregular water flow that can cause inconvenience and water wastage. Repair work may involve replacing worn-out washers, seals, or cartridges, tightening loose components, or fixing damaged valve mechanisms. These services are essential for restoring proper function and ensuring that the bathtub faucet operates smoothly and efficiently.

Many common problems are solved through bathtub faucet repair. Leaking faucets can lead to increased water bills and potential water damage if not addressed promptly. Difficulty in turning the faucet on or off, inconsistent water temperature, or low water pressure are signs that repairs may be needed. Additionally, corrosion or mineral buildup can impair the faucet’s performance. Local contractors can identify the root cause of these issues and provide effective solutions to restore proper operation, preventing further damage or inconvenience.

The overview below groups typical Bathtub Faucet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most routine bathtub faucet rep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ing washers, typically cost between $150 and $400. Many projects in this range are straightforward and completed quickly by local contractors. Fewer jobs fall into the higher end of this spectrum unless additional parts or labor are needed.

Part Replacement - Replacing a single faucet component, like a cartridge or valve, generally ranges from $200 to $600. This is a common scope for many repair projects, with costs varying based on the specific part and faucet model. Larger, more complex replacements can push costs higher but are less frequent.

Full Faucet Replacement - Installing a new bathtub faucet can cost between $400 and $1,200, depending on the faucet style and installation complexity. Many local service providers handle these projects within this range, while premium or designer fixtures may increase the price.

Extensive Repairs or Upgrades - Larger, more involved repairs or upgrades, such as plumbing reroutes or fixture overhauls, can range from $1,500 to $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ically require detailed assessments by local pros to determine exact cost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
